MacRuby | это... Что такое MacRuby? (original) (raw)

MacRuby

Тип интерпретатор, компилятор
Разработчик Laurent Sansonetti (Apple Inc.)
Написана на C, C++, Objective-C
Операционная система Mac OS X
Последняя версия 0.10 (23 марта 2011[1])
Состояние активное
Лицензия Ruby License
Сайт www.macruby.org

MacRuby — это реализация языка программирования Ruby, который написан на Objective-C и фрейморке CoreFoundation и разработан компанией Apple Inc. и предназначен для замены RubyCocoa[2]. Он базируется на версии Руби 1.9 и использует высокопроизводительный компилятор начиная с версии 0.5.

MacRuby поддерживает Interface Builder и поставляется с библиотекой, называющейся HotCocoa, предназначенной для упрощения программирования под Cocoa. MacRuby также используется в качестве встраемого языка в приложениях на Objective-C[3].

См. также

Примечания

  1. Блог MacRuby.
  2. Discussion of MacRuby as a replacement for RubyCocoa.
  3. Embedding MacRuby For Application Scripting.

Ссылки

Просмотр этого шаблона Ruby (категория)
IDE ActiveState KomodoEric • RubyForge • RadRailsRubyMine
Реализации Ruby MRI • YARVJRubyIronRubyRubinius • XRuby • MacRuby • RubyJS • HotRuby
Приложения RubyGemsRakeInteractive Ruby Shell • Capistrano • Hackety Hack
Библиотеки и фреймворки Adhearsion • Camping • eRuby (RHTML) • Hobo • Merb • Nitro • RubyCocoa • Ruby on Rails • Ramaze • Sinatra • Padrino • QtRuby
Серверное ПО Mongrel • Phusion Passenger (mod_rails/mod_rack) • WEBrick • mod_ruby
Прочее Application Archives • Document format • Book Guides • Ruby Central • RubyKaigi